The 57-year-old Paul Heyman is considered to be one of the greatest wrestling managers in history. In his ECW days, he more than often roasted pretty much every superstar that crossed his path. And recently, Heyman confirmed that he is still that guy.

Without a doubt, Paul Heyman is gold on the mic. His mic skills rival that of John Cena and The Rock. Throughout his long career in WWE, Paul Heyman has managed a lot of WWE wrestlers. He did the talking, while his wrestlers did the fighting. To say that he was good at his job is an understatement, as he not only managed the wrestlers really well but also destroyed their opponents on the mic. Although in doing so, he would mostly be on the receiving end of a beatdown.

In a recent video clip on Twitter, fans were reliving the good old days when Paul Heyman absolutely demolished JBL in a segment. The tweet was captioned “Paul Heyman was brutal!”. Heyman quickly took notice of the tweet, promising his fans that he was still as brutal as he was back then. He just keeps the brutality a bit in check, as he said, “Wisdom prevails on the Island of Relevancy!“.

FS Video

In the video clip, Paul Heyman can be seen taking a jab at JBL, who was the WWE World Heavyweight Champion at that time. His championship reign was disliked by many, as they thought that JBL was an undeserving champion. His extensive title reign came at the cost of many popular wrestlers, including The Undertaker, Eddie Guerrero, and Booker T. In the clip, Paul Heyman tells JBL that the only reason he was still the WWE Champion was because Triple H didn’t want to work Tuesdays. This was meant to convey that JBL wouldn’t stand a chance at retaining his title if The Game came after him.

What is Paul Heyman doing now?

Paul Heyman is best known for being the manager of The Beast, Brock Lesnar, for about 20 years. He did a pretty splendid job at being Brock Lesnar’s manager. Heyman did all the talking for him while The Beast did all the dirty work. He betrayed Lesnar multiple times in his career but ended up getting back together with him.

Paul Heyman eventually turned against The Beast and joined forces with Roman Reigns. Ever since joining Reigns, he has remained loyal to The Tribal Chief. He is currently also managing The Bloodline, a villainous stable formed by Roman Reigns.
